Job Summary

The Senior Commercial Electrical Estimator is responsible for leading the estimating process for commercial electrical construction projects and developing accurate, competitive, and comprehensive proposal packages for client turnover. This role will estimate projects up to $100MM , depending on project complexity, scope, and self-perform requirements.

The Senior Commercial Electrical Estimator will work closely with the Chief Estimator, Preconstruction, Project Management, Operations, vendors, subcontractors, and customers to develop competitive estimates, identify project risks, and ensure successful project turnover.

Essential Job Responsibilities

  • Lead estimates for commercial electrical construction projects with sizes and scopes up to $100MM, depending on complexity.
  • Develop detailed electrical estimates, including material, labor, equipment, subcontractor, and indirect costs.
  • Perform and validate detailed electrical quantity takeoffs using estimating software.
  • Review and interpret electrical drawings, specifications, scopes of work, contract documents, and project requirements.
